Sdílet prostřednictvím


ModelingEnumerationConverter – třída

Obsahuje typ převaděč, který převádí mezi hodnoty Vyčíslení domény a text.

Hierarchie dědičnosti

System.Object
  System.ComponentModel.TypeConverter
    Microsoft.VisualStudio.Modeling.Design.ModelingEnumerationConverter

Obor názvů:  Microsoft.VisualStudio.Modeling.Design
Sestavení:  Microsoft.VisualStudio.Modeling.Sdk.12.0 (v Microsoft.VisualStudio.Modeling.Sdk.12.0.dll)

Syntaxe

'Deklarace
Public Class ModelingEnumerationConverter _
    Inherits TypeConverter
public class ModelingEnumerationConverter : TypeConverter

Typ ModelingEnumerationConverter zveřejňuje následující členy.

Konstruktory

  Název Popis
Veřejná metoda ModelingEnumerationConverter Inicializuje novou instanci ModelingEnumerationConverter třídy pro vlastnost zadanou doménu.

Nahoru

Vlastnosti

  Název Popis
Chráněná vlastnost Comparer Získává IComparer objekt, který lze objednat hodnoty výčtu.
Chráněná vlastnost Values Kolekce hodnot konstant získá ve výčtu.

Nahoru

Metody

  Název Popis
Veřejná metoda CanConvertFrom(Type) Vrátí se, zda tento převaděč lze převést objekt daného typu typ tento převaděč. (Zděděno z TypeConverter.)
Veřejná metoda CanConvertFrom(ITypeDescriptorContext, Type) Označuje, zda tento převaděč převést objekt v dané zdroje typ výčtu objektu domény pomocí zadaného kontextu. (Přepisuje TypeConverter.CanConvertFrom(ITypeDescriptorContext, Type).)
Veřejná metoda CanConvertTo(Type) Vrátí se, zda tento převaděč lze objekt převést na zadaný typ. (Zděděno z TypeConverter.)
Veřejná metoda CanConvertTo(ITypeDescriptorContext, Type) Označuje, zda tento převaděč lze převést objekt domény výčtu na zadaný typ pomocí určeného kontextu. (Přepisuje TypeConverter.CanConvertTo(ITypeDescriptorContext, Type).)
Veřejná metoda ConvertFrom(Object) Převede hodnotu daného typu Tento převaděč. (Zděděno z TypeConverter.)
Veřejná metoda ConvertFrom(ITypeDescriptorContext, CultureInfo, Object) Převede objekt zadanou hodnotu výčtu objektu domény pomocí zadaného kontextu. (Přepisuje TypeConverter.ConvertFrom(ITypeDescriptorContext, CultureInfo, Object).)
Veřejná metoda ConvertFromInvariantString(String) Převede daný řetězec typu Tento převaděč, pomocí výchozí kultury. (Zděděno z TypeConverter.)
Veřejná metoda ConvertFromInvariantString(ITypeDescriptorContext, String) Převede daný řetězec typu Tento převaděč, pomocí výchozí kultury a zadaný kontext. (Zděděno z TypeConverter.)
Veřejná metoda ConvertFromString(String) Zadaný text se převede na objekt. (Zděděno z TypeConverter.)
Veřejná metoda ConvertFromString(ITypeDescriptorContext, String) Převede daný text na objekt pomocí určeného kontextu. (Zděděno z TypeConverter.)
Veřejná metoda ConvertFromString(ITypeDescriptorContext, CultureInfo, String) Převede daný text objektu pomocí zadané informace kontextu a kultury. (Zděděno z TypeConverter.)
Veřejná metoda ConvertTo(Object, Type) Převede objekt dané hodnoty na zadaný typ pomocí argumentů. (Zděděno z TypeConverter.)
Veřejná metoda ConvertTo(ITypeDescriptorContext, CultureInfo, Object, Type) Pomocí zadaného kontextu převede zadaný typ výčtu objektu domény. (Přepisuje TypeConverter.ConvertTo(ITypeDescriptorContext, CultureInfo, Object, Type).)
Veřejná metoda ConvertToInvariantString(Object) Zadaná hodnota se převede na kultury invariant řetězce. (Zděděno z TypeConverter.)
Veřejná metoda ConvertToInvariantString(ITypeDescriptorContext, Object) Zadaná hodnota se převede na reprezentaci kultury invariant řetězec, pomocí určeného kontextu. (Zděděno z TypeConverter.)
Veřejná metoda ConvertToString(Object) Zadaná hodnota se převede do řetězce. (Zděděno z TypeConverter.)
Veřejná metoda ConvertToString(ITypeDescriptorContext, Object) Převede danou hodnotu řetězcové vyjádření, v daném kontextu. (Zděděno z TypeConverter.)
Veřejná metoda ConvertToString(ITypeDescriptorContext, CultureInfo, Object) Převede danou hodnotu řetězcové vyjádření, pomocí zadaného kontextu a kultury informace. (Zděděno z TypeConverter.)
Veřejná metoda CreateInstance(IDictionary) Znovu vytvoří Object dané sady hodnot vlastností pro objekt. (Zděděno z TypeConverter.)
Veřejná metoda CreateInstance(ITypeDescriptorContext, IDictionary) Vytvoří instanci typu, který to TypeConverter je spojená s použitím zadaného kontextu dané sady hodnot vlastností pro objekt. (Zděděno z TypeConverter.)
Veřejná metoda Equals Určuje, zda se zadaný objekt rovná aktuálnímu objektu. (Zděděno z Object.)
Chráněná metoda Finalize Umožňuje objektu k pokusu uvolnit prostředky a provádět další operace vyčištění před je zažádáno systémem uvolňování paměti. (Zděděno z Object.)
Chráněná metoda GetConvertFromException Vrátí výjimku throw, pokud nelze provést převod. (Zděděno z TypeConverter.)
Chráněná metoda GetConvertToException Vrátí výjimku throw, pokud nelze provést převod. (Zděděno z TypeConverter.)
Veřejná metoda GetCreateInstanceSupported() Vrátí se, zda změna hodnoty tohoto objektu vyžaduje volání CreateInstance k vytvoření nové hodnoty. (Zděděno z TypeConverter.)
Veřejná metoda GetCreateInstanceSupported(ITypeDescriptorContext) Vrátí se, zda změna hodnoty tohoto objektu vyžaduje volání CreateInstance vytvořte novou hodnotu pomocí určeného kontextu. (Zděděno z TypeConverter.)
Veřejná metoda GetHashCode Slouží jako výchozí funkce hash. (Zděděno z Object.)
Veřejná metoda GetProperties(Object) Vrátí kolekci vlastnosti typu pole zadána hodnota parametru. (Zděděno z TypeConverter.)
Veřejná metoda GetProperties(ITypeDescriptorContext, Object) Vrátí kolekci vlastnosti typu pole určeného parametrem hodnota pomocí určeného kontextu. (Zděděno z TypeConverter.)
Veřejná metoda GetProperties(ITypeDescriptorContext, Object, array<Attribute[]) Vrátí kolekci vlastnosti typu pole určeného parametrem hodnota pomocí zadaného kontextu a atributy. (Zděděno z TypeConverter.)
Veřejná metoda GetPropertiesSupported() Vrátí se, zda tento objekt podporuje vlastnosti. (Zděděno z TypeConverter.)
Veřejná metoda GetPropertiesSupported(ITypeDescriptorContext) Vrátí se, zda tento objekt podporuje vlastnosti pomocí určeného kontextu. (Zděděno z TypeConverter.)
Veřejná metoda GetStandardValues() Vrátí kolekci standardní hodnoty z kontextu výchozí typ dat, které tento převaděč typ je určen pro. (Zděděno z TypeConverter.)
Veřejná metoda GetStandardValues(ITypeDescriptorContext) Vrátí kolekci standardní hodnoty pro typ dat, který tento převaděč typ je určen pro když formát kontextu. (Přepisuje TypeConverter.GetStandardValues(ITypeDescriptorContext).)
Veřejná metoda GetStandardValuesExclusive() Vrátí, zda kolekce standardních hodnot vrácených z GetStandardValues je výhradní seznam. (Zděděno z TypeConverter.)
Veřejná metoda GetStandardValuesExclusive(ITypeDescriptorContext) Udává, zda kolekce standardních hodnot z GetStandardValues metoda je výhradní seznam pomocí zadaného kontextu. (Přepisuje TypeConverter.GetStandardValuesExclusive(ITypeDescriptorContext).)
Veřejná metoda GetStandardValuesSupported() Vrátí se, zda tento objekt podporuje standardní sadu hodnot, které lze vydat ze seznamu. (Zděděno z TypeConverter.)
Veřejná metoda GetStandardValuesSupported(ITypeDescriptorContext) Označuje, zda tento objekt podporuje standardní sadu hodnot, které lze vydat ze seznamu, pomocí zadaného kontextu. (Přepisuje TypeConverter.GetStandardValuesSupported(ITypeDescriptorContext).)
Veřejná metoda GetType Získá Type aktuální instance. (Zděděno z Object.)
Veřejná metoda IsValid(Object) Vrátí se, zda je platný pro tento typ objektu dané hodnoty. (Zděděno z TypeConverter.)
Veřejná metoda IsValid(ITypeDescriptorContext, Object) Vrátí se, zda je objekt dané hodnoty platné pro tento typ a zadaný kontext. (Zděděno z TypeConverter.)
Chráněná metoda MemberwiseClone Vytvoří mělká kopie aktuálního Object. (Zděděno z Object.)
Chráněná metoda SortProperties Seřadí sadu vlastností. (Zděděno z TypeConverter.)
Veřejná metoda ToString Vrací řetězec, který představuje aktuální objekt. (Zděděno z Object.)

Nahoru

Bezpečný přístup z více vláken

Všechny veřejné členy static (Shared v jazyce Visual Basic) tohoto typu jsou bezpečné pro přístup z více vláken. Není zaručeno, že členy instancí jsou bezpečné pro přístup z více vláken.

Viz také

Referenční dokumentace

Microsoft.VisualStudio.Modeling.Design – obor názvů

FlagEnumerationEditor

TypeConverterAttribute